    Default Hole in the wall: Oriental Spice Gourmet

    I went there before they closed today. Had the nasi goreng, beef rendang with half cup of steamed rice, and char kway teow. All items were excellent at a very reasonable price.

    I wanted hainanese chicken rice but it isn't Wednesday.

    Service was way faster than any fast food joint I've eaten at. Istorya has the correct phone number.

    The wife was ultra friendly and accommodating. It is as if you've been friends for years. You just instantly feel comfortable with her.

    Mary ann tells me that she is used to rushed service because a lot of travelers tend to eat at her place before flying out.

    I like how near it is to the airport.

    On an odd side note they have the best smelling bathroom I've ever been to.
